Step-by-Step Process

Now for the fun part—let’s get cooking! Follow these clear, numbered instructions:

  1. Preheat your oven to 350° F ( 175° C) . You want that heat just right when your oats go in.
  2. Combine the oats, almond milk, mashed banana, baking powder, vanilla, and salt in a mixing bowl. Mix it up well!
  3. Let it sit for 5 minutes to thicken . This is like a mini spa day for your oats.
  4. Spread half of the mixture into a greased baking dish.
  5. Dollop Nutella on top, then swirl it around for that decadent look.
  6. Pour the remaining oat mixture over the Nutella layer. Who doesn't love more layers, right?
  7. Bake for 25- 30 minutes . You can check for doneness with a toothpick—it should come out clean.
  8. Cool slightly before serving. This helps set the texture and avoids burnt taste buds!

Preparation time:

10 Mins
Cooking time:

25 Mins
Yield:
🍽️
2-4 servings

⚖️ Ingredients:

  • 1 cup (90g) rolled oats
  • 2 cups (480ml) unsweetened almond milk
  • 1 medium ripe banana, mashed
  • 1 teaspoon baking powder
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1/4 teaspoon salt
  • 1/4 cup (60g) Nutella (more for drizzling, if desired)
  • Optional: Fresh berries or sliced bananas for garnish

🥄 Instructions:

  1. Step 1: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C).
  2. Step 2: In a mixing bowl, combine the rolled oats, almond milk, mashed banana, baking powder, vanilla extract, and salt.
  3. Step 3: Mix well until fully combined and let sit for 5 minutes to thicken slightly.
  4. Step 4: Spread half of the oat mixture into the bottom of a greased baking dish.
  5. Step 5: Dollop the Nutella on top of the oat mixture, using a spoon to create a swirl.
  6. Step 6: Pour the remaining oat mixture over the Nutella layer and smooth the top.
  7. Step 7: Bake in the preheated oven for 25-30 minutes, or until golden and set, checking for doneness with a toothpick.
  8. Step 8: Cool slightly before serving, and drizzle additional Nutella if desired.
